Originally issued in 1970, I LOOKED UP represents the end of the Robin/Mike/Likky/Rose period of the Incredible String Band. Later that same year would see te release of the 2-lp set U, which would introduce new faces and influences into the melting pot that was the 'sound' of the ISB.

Other than being the last album by this line-up, I LOOKED UP is notable for several other reasons -- for one thing, it was the last album they recorded that was mostly acoustic (I don't consider the occasional presence of a quiet electric guitar to be as poisonous as some might). It also contains two of Robin Williamson's most memorable compositions: 'When you find out who you are' is an insightful treatise on growing older and 'finding' onself -- something we all go through, whether we pay attention to it or not; and the simply amazing 'Pictures in a mirror', which takes Lord Randall through imprisonment, execution, death, darkness and ultimate rebirth, all in less than 11 minutes. Robin's works always tended more toward the mystical than Mike's (with some exceptions on both sides -- neither writer's scope was so narrow as to never wander...), and this song is a sterling example of his mind-stretching perceptions.

Mike Heron contributes some nice tunes as well, although not quite as 'deep', at least in this outing. 'Black Jack David' begins the album, a rousing fiddle tune -- it quickly became a concert favorite. 'The letter' is my least favorite track here, Heron's attempt at a pop song -- but his other two offerings in this set are excellent: 'This moment' is almost Zen-like in its view of reality-as-now; and 'Fair as you' is simply a touchingly beautiful love song, sung as a call-and-response duet with Likky McKechnie. Her child-like voice was one of the ISB's sweetest 'trademark' sounds during the period during which she was associated with the band.

Not their greatest effort, but certainly a fine collection of well-written tunes. With the advent of U, Malcom LeMaistre would come on board, and beginning with LIQUID ACROBAT AS REGARDS THE AIR a couple of years down the road, their sound would turn increasingly electric and (if you can believe it from their early work) 'pop', undoubtedly, to some extent, brought on by pressure from their record companies to become more 'marketable'.

They're back together now, in 2001: Robin Williamson, Mike Heron, and Clive Palmer -- the three original members, from the very first album -- along with Bina Williamson and Dawson Lando (I hope I've gotten his name right! If not, sorry...) from Robin's latest band. We'll see how well they can revive the old magic..!

It is hard to imagine that this album was written after the clunkiness of changing horses (though a must have if for "Creation" alone); in this Robin Williamson and Mike Heron managed to sustain the creative spirit that made their first five albums so good. Every song on here is a must have, my favorites being "Pictures in a Mirror" (got to love Robin's gypsy shriek) and "When you find out who you are". This album is an essential for any ISB fan, full of the classic ISB flavor you know and love. If you loved the imagery and magical quality of "The Hangman's Beautiful daughter" you will love this album. Mike Heron was also in fine form when he wrote "This Moment", each chord change is like waves washing over your ears. Every song on here is a trip to another world.

The Incredible String Band released I Looked Up - their seventh studio album - in 1970. Produced once again by the ever reliable Joe Boyd, this is a joy to listen to. The various instruments sound clear and loud in rich textures and the voices are just pure fun! Mike Heron contributes four songs and Robin Williamson two. Mike's tunes are shorter and a bit more to the point whereas Robin's are basically the opposite running over ten minutes long. This - as on their other albums - creates great chemistry and it is still very much alive on I Looked Up which is clearly an inspired follow-up to Changing Horses.

Mike actually writes the sleeve notes which offers interesting details of their time around the writing process of the album and provides lyrics for two songs - Pictures In A Mirror and Fair As You. Mike himself writes: "There is no doubt that I Looked Up is a transitional album - wandering rather than driven - but maybe the best String Band moments were when the compass was mislaid".

While I wouldn't say this was their highest achievement, it should still manage to fascinate anyone who's into them. So I'm basically saying that if you got some of their other albums, there is plenty of stuff here that should easily please you. Music as daring and inventive as this is long gone. Don't overlook it!
